Diyala police denies the existence of threats against some medical personnel in the province

Baquba, The Diyala Police Command denied reports circulating about threats against some medical personnel in the province.

The command stated in a statement that, after communicating with the head of the Diyala Doctors Syndicate, Murtada Ibrahim Al-Khazraji, who confirmed that there was no explicit threat preventing the provision of humanitarian services to patients in hospitals and outpatient clinics.

For his part, Diyala Police Commander Major General Alaa Gharib said that the police command will spare no effort to ensure protection for all government institutions and departments and to maintain the security of citizens in all areas of the province.
